Bobcats Crowned Back‑to‑Back Big Sky Academic Champions
Montana State's women's basketball squad has been crowned the 2025‑26 Big Sky Team Academic Champion for the second consecutive season, a distinction that underscores the program's commitment to scholarly excellence.
The Bobcats posted a program‑wide grade point average of 3.76 during the 2025‑26 campaign, the highest among all Big Sky women's basketball teams, while also establishing a new conference benchmark of 57 cumulative wins over the last two years.
Eight players from the roster earned Big Sky All‑Academic honors, and five of them achieved perfect 4.0 GPAs, highlighting the depth of academic talent within the team.
Commissioner Tom Wistrcill praised the student‑athletes' classroom achievements, noting that the academic awards were introduced four years ago to spotlight such performances.
Montana State's academic standing also placed 11th nationally in the Women's Basketball Coaches Association team GPA rankings, reflecting the program's broader impact.
Head coach Tricia Binford has guided the Bobcats to eight top‑15 academic finishes in program history, reinforcing the team's consistent excellence both on the court and in the classroom.
